Human skull-carrying dog stuns residents


By ALEX NJOVU

A DOG stunned Luanshya’s Maposa farm block residents when it emerged from a nearby bush with a human skull.
Copperbelt commissioner of police Mary Tembo said the incident happened on Tuesday around 11:30 hours when the dog, belonging to an 80-year-old woman identified as Mandalena Kofe, emerged from a thicket with a human skull.
“We have a case where a dog was seen carrying a human skull. It was coming from a nearby bush within the settlement when it was spotted with a human skull,” Ms Tembo said.
she said officers from Luanshya Municipal Council grabbed the skull from the dog and buried it immediately.
She said police have instituted investigations into the matter.
And police in Luanshya are looking for a 20-year- old woman who allegedly abandoned her newly-born baby after delivering at Mpatamatu clinic.
Ms Tembo said Astridah Junza allegedly abandoned the baby soon after she delivered on Tuesday.
“This woman gave false information about herself and the address. She gave hospital workers wrong information about her house in Mpatamato.
“She told the workers that she had left clothes for the baby at home and when she was allowed to go and collect them, she never went back to the clinic. The baby is in an incubator because it is underweight. The baby weighed 1.9 kilogrammes at birth,” Ms Tembo said.
